If you are being sued for debt that IS yours, we recommend the following:
Go to the NACA Find an Attorney Website by clicking here, Filter by your State, and then Filter by Area of Practice “Debt Collection –> Debt Defense.”
ALSO search local legal aid (Google the one in your home County).
